2.9. Driving aids (where fitted)
| System name | Abbreviation | Icon | Description | Page | 
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Emergency Lane Assist* | ELA | 
 
 
 | The ELA system warns the driver when the vehicle approaches the road edge or solid white line and assists the driver to return the vehicle to the carriageway. | |
| Steering Assist* | — | 
 
 
 | The Steering Assist system assists the driver in keeping the vehicle in the centre of the travelling lane. Steering Assist also incorporates ELA. | |
| Cruise Control* | — | 
 
 
 | The Cruise Control system allows the driver to set and keep a constant vehicle speed. | |
| Intelligent Cruise Control (with Steering Assist)* | ICC | 
 
 
 | The ICC system allows the driver to set and keep either a constant distance to the vehicle ahead or set vehicle speed. | |
| Intelligent Cruise Control (without Steering Assist)* | ICC | 
 
 
 | The ICC system allows the driver to set and keep either a constant distance to the vehicle ahead or set vehicle speed. | |
| ProPILOT Assist* or Drive Assist* | — | 
 
 
 | The ProPILOT Assist or Drive Assist systems combine the Intelligent Cruise Control and Steering Assist. | |
| Speed limiter* | — | 
 
 
 | The speed limiter allows you to set the desired vehicle speed limit. | |
| Blind Spot Warning* | BSW | 
 
 
 | While driving, the BSW system helps alert the driver to the presence of other vehicles in adjacent lanes. | |
| Intelligent Emergency Braking* | IEB | 
 
 
 | The IEB system can assist the driver when there is a risk of a forward collision with the vehicle ahead in the travelling lane or with a pedestrian or cyclist. | |
| Rear Cross Traffic Alert* | RCTA | 
 
 
 | When the vehicle is in reverse, the RCTA system is designed to detect other vehicles approaching from the right or left of the vehicle. | |
| Rear Automatic Braking* | RAB | 
 
 
 | When the vehicle is in reverse, The RAB system can assist the driver when there is a risk of a collision with an obstacle behind the vehicle. | |
| Anti-lock Braking System | ABS | 
 
 
 | The ABS controls the brakes so the wheels do not lock during hard braking or when braking on slippery surfaces. | |
| Electronic Stability Programme | ESP | 
 
 
 | The ESP system adjusts wheel brake pressure and engine torque to assist in improving vehicle stability. | |
| Hill Start Assist* | HSA | 
 
 
 | The Hill Start Assist system automatically keeps the brakes applied to help prevent the vehicle from rolling backwards when stopped on a hill. | |
| Traffic Sign recognition* (Type A) | TSR | 
 
 
 
 
 
 
 | The TSR system provides the driver with information about the most recently detected speed limit, using the speed limit display and overspeed warning function. | |
| Traffic Sign recognition* (Type B) | TSR | 
 
 
 | The TSR system provides the driver with information about the most recently detected speed limit. | |
| Intelligent Driver Alertness* | IDA | 
 
 
 | The Intelligent Driver Alertness system helps alert the driver when a lack of attention or driving fatigue is detected. | 
*where fitted
